diff --git a/src/net/parse.cpp b/src/net/parse.cpp
index 1df6175b4..92be492a3 100644
--- a/src/net/parse.cpp
+++ b/src/net/parse.cpp
@@ -38,7 +38,7 @@ namespace net
{
void get_network_address_host_and_port(const std::string& address, std::string& host, std::string& port)
{
- // require ipv6 address format "[addr:addr:addr:...:addr]:port"
+ // If IPv6 address format with port "[addr:addr:addr:...:addr]:port"
if (address.find(']') != std::string::npos)
{
host = address.substr(1, address.rfind(']') - 1);
@@ -47,6 +47,12 @@ namespace net
port = address.substr(address.rfind(':') + 1);
}
}
+ // Else if IPv6 address format without port e.g. "addr:addr:addr:...:addr"
+ else if (std::count(address.begin(), address.end(), ':') >= 2)
+ {
+ host = address;
+ }
+ // Else IPv4, Tor, I2P address or hostname
else
{
host = address.substr(0, address.rfind(':'));
diff --git a/src/net/parse.h b/src/net/parse.h
index 648076d7b..6ece931c6 100644
--- a/src/net/parse.h
+++ b/src/net/parse.h
@@ -38,6 +38,16 @@
namespace net
{
+ /*!
+ * \brief Takes a valid address string (IP, Tor, I2P, or DNS name) and splits it into host and port
+ *
+ * The host of an IPv6 addresses in the format "[x:x:..:x]:port" will have the braces stripped.
+ * For example, when the address is "[ffff::2023]", host will be set to "ffff::2023".
+ *
+ * \param address The address string one wants to split
+ * \param[out] host The host part of the address string. Is always set.
+ * \param[out] port The port part of the address string. Is only set when address string contains a port.
+ */
void get_network_address_host_and_port(const std::string& address, std::string& host, std::string& port);
